Pretreatment/Clean Water Act Enforcement: Mississippi Commission on Environmental Quality and Verona Manufacturing Facility Enter into Agreed Order

The Mississippi Commission on Environmental Quality (“MCEQ”) and MTD Products Company (“MTD”) entered into a May 17th Agreed Order (“AO”) addressing alleged violations of a Clean Water Act Pretreatment Permit. See Order No. 7190 22.

The AO indicates that MTD operates a facility in Verona, Mississippi.

The facility holds Pretreatment Permit No. MSP090126.

Alleged violations of the Pretreatment Permit are stated to include:

  • Exceedance of effluent Oil and Grease concentration monthly average limitations on outfall 001 during the months of February 2021, March 2021, April 2021, June 2021, July 2021, and September 2021
  • Exceedance of Oil and Grease concentration daily maximum limitations on outfall 001 during the months of February 2021, March 2021, April 2021, June 2021, July 2021, and September 2021.
  • Report of a NODI Code E – Failed to Sample/Required Analysis not conducted, for the effluent Total Toxic Organics concentration and loading limitations on outfall 001 and 003 for the January through June 2021 monitoring period

MTD, through letters dated February 22nd and March 28th, documented corrective actions taken to address the referenced alleged violations to the Pretreatment Permit. Further, MTD indicated to MCEQ in March 28th correspondence that it has returned to compliance with the Pretreatment Permit.

The AO provides that it does not constitute an admission of liability by MTD.

A civil penalty of $8,800 is assessed.
